The US Controlled Substances Act regulates prescription of different types of medications. So, according to this schedule, the most restricted medicines like Heroin belong to Schedule I.
Schedule II includes the medicines with a high potential for abuse which are administered with severe medical restrictions because the abuse of any drug of the group may lead to bad psychological or physical addiction. No wonder, the Drug Enforcement Administration has classified Hydrocodone as a Schedule II opioid.
Schedule III includes the drugs with some potential for abuse, but it is less possible than with the drugs or other substances belonging to Schedules I and II. Such drugs have a currently accepted medical use all over the world because no strict medical control is needed. Abuse of Schedule III includes the pills may lead to moderate or low physical addiction but high psychological addiction. That is why if the drugs have a certain quantity of Hydrocodone combined with other drugs, these compounds are classified as Schedule III controlled substances.

Please, do not fail to remember that symptoms of Hydrocodone addiction include:
- developing withdrawal symptoms if a current Hydrocodone dose is missed;
- continued use of Hydrocodone after pain has been soothed;
- visiting multiple GPs to obtain Hydrocodone prescriptions;
- withdrawal from friends, family and usual enjoyable activities;
- secretive behavior;
- changes in mood and behavior accompanied by adverse effects as decreased sex drive; confusion; hallucinations; dizziness; nausea or vomiting; lethargy; irregular breathing.

As we have explained before, Hydrocodone is physically addictive and if you attempt to quit it “cold-turkey”, it can lead you to seizures. Depending on the intensity of Hydrocodone intake you can experience transient to severe seizures. As a rule, it takes any opioid medication about a week to leave a personality’s body. During this period of time the Hydrocodone user will face different withdrawal symptoms including:
- anxiety and restlessness;
- depression;
- extreme cravings for Hydrocodone;
- vomiting and diarrhea;
- insomnia and nightmares;
- severe muscle and bone pain (flue-like symptoms).
These withdrawal signs can become so intolerable that the person can be sent back to Hydrocodone use. The most tricky part is that Hydrocodone euphoria after withdrawal syndrome forms a strong psychological addiction, too!
Sorry to say that Hydrocodone addiction does not end with the end of withdrawal syndrome. You have to be very careful and clever to prevent future relapse and ensure long-term recovery.
Hydrocodone withdrawal signs normally last for 10-14 fourteen days. If you manage to survive this terrible torture, you have won a half of a battle!
